Week 2:
The purpose of this week is for each group of students to establish whether they have a healthy lifestyle. By conducting surveys of what each student had for breakfast, the time they go to bed and the exercise activities they take part in, the students will collect, record and analyse numerical data. The students write a review of the collected data giving them the opportunity to write in a style that is appropriate to the task sharing information. The students use the data submitted in week 1 to compare their hair and eye colour with other students around the world. The students use the descriptive text accounts to find information about other participating groups of students. |
